对象存储定义接口有哪些特点,深入解析对象存储定义接口,特点与关键技术剖析
- 综合资讯
- 2024-11-10 02:54:11
- 2

对象存储定义接口具有标准化、可扩展、易集成等特点。本文深入解析对象存储定义接口,剖析其关键技术,包括接口规范、数据模型、安全性与性能优化等方面,旨在为开发者提供全面的了...
对象存储定义接口具有标准化、可扩展、易集成等特点。本文深入解析对象存储定义接口,剖析其关键技术,包括接口规范、数据模型、安全性与性能优化等方面,旨在为开发者提供全面的了解。
随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足日益增长的数据存储需求,对象存储作为一种新兴的存储技术,凭借其独特的优势,逐渐成为企业级存储的解决方案,本文将从对象存储定义接口的特点出发,深入剖析其关键技术,以期为相关从业者提供参考。
对象存储定义接口特点
1、数据存储粒度小
对象存储将数据以对象的形式进行存储,每个对象包含数据本身、元数据和访问控制信息,相比传统存储方式,对象存储的粒度更小,便于管理和优化。
2、易于扩展
对象存储采用分布式存储架构,可以轻松扩展存储容量和性能,当存储需求增加时,只需添加新的存储节点,即可实现线性扩展。
3、高可靠性
对象存储系统通过数据冗余、数据校验和故障转移等机制,保证数据的可靠性,即使在部分节点故障的情况下,也能保证数据的完整性和可用性。
4、良好的兼容性
对象存储定义接口遵循一系列国际标准,如S3、OpenStack Swift等,便于与其他存储系统和应用程序的集成。
5、支持多协议访问
对象存储定义接口支持多种访问协议,如HTTP、HTTPS、RESTful API等,便于用户根据需求选择合适的访问方式。
6、强大的元数据管理
对象存储定义接口提供丰富的元数据管理功能,包括对象标签、分类、查询等,便于用户对数据进行精细化管理。
7、高效的数据传输
对象存储定义接口采用高效的数据传输协议,如HTTP/2、QUIC等,降低数据传输延迟,提高数据传输效率。
8、良好的安全性
对象存储定义接口支持数据加密、访问控制、安全审计等功能,保障数据的安全性。
对象存储定义接口关键技术
1、分布式存储架构
分布式存储架构是实现对象存储高效、可靠的关键技术,通过将数据分散存储在多个节点上,可以降低单点故障风险,提高系统可用性。
2、数据冗余和校验
数据冗余和校验是保证数据可靠性的关键技术,通过在多个节点上存储相同数据,并使用校验算法进行数据校验,可以确保数据在传输和存储过程中的完整性。
3、故障转移和恢复
故障转移和恢复是实现系统高可靠性的关键技术,当存储节点出现故障时,系统应自动将数据转移到其他节点,保证数据的可用性。
4、数据索引和查询
数据索引和查询是实现高效数据访问的关键技术,通过建立数据索引,可以快速定位所需数据,提高查询效率。
5、元数据管理
元数据管理是实现数据精细化管理的关键技术,通过管理对象的元数据,可以方便地对数据进行分类、查询和统计。
6、安全性保障
安全性保障是实现数据安全的关键技术,通过数据加密、访问控制、安全审计等措施,确保数据在存储、传输和处理过程中的安全性。
对象存储定义接口具有数据存储粒度小、易于扩展、高可靠性、良好兼容性、支持多协议访问、强大的元数据管理、高效的数据传输和良好的安全性等特点,随着互联网技术的不断发展,对象存储将在数据存储领域发挥越来越重要的作用,了解对象存储定义接口的特点和关键技术,有助于相关从业者更好地应用和推广对象存储技术。
本文链接:https://www.zhitaoyun.cn/722189.html
发表评论